Pumped storage hydropower or pumped hydroelectric storage is to date one of the most proven techno-economic solutions for long-term storage of energy. The worldwide installed pumped storage capacity is more than 165 GW and represents practically the entire storage capacity of the world.

Industry The Indian Central Electricity Authority (CEA) has approved two new pumped-storage hydropower projects in India''s Maharashtra State, totalling a capacity of 2.5 GW. The two projects are the 1.5 GW Bhavali PSP, developed by JSW Energy, and the 1 GW Bhivpuri PSP, developed by Tata Power. Both projects are expected to be commissioned in 2028 and provide

Industry Hydropower accounts for 10% of India''s total capacity at end-2023, with 52.1 GW, including 4.8 GW of pumped-storage. In late 2021, India announced plans to add 79 hydropower projects with a total capacity of 30 GW, including 11 pumped-storage projects totalling 8.7 GW, during the period 2019-2020 to 2029-2030.

Pumped-storage energy storage projects involve pumping upstream the turbined fluid from one reservoir to a higher reservoir to store it and, when energy is needed, releasing the water to flow downstream through the turbines, generating electricity on its way to the lower reservoir.
Industry PRINCIPLES OF PUMPED STORAGE Pumped storage schemes store electric energy by pumping water from a lower reservoir into an upper reservoir when there is a surplus of electrical energy in a power grid. During periods of high energy demand the water is released back through the turbines and electricity is generated and fed into the grid. Pumped

“The largest market driver of pumped storage is aggressive renewable energy goals that are pushing regional power grids to the edge of instability,” says Don Erpenbeck, global market sector leader for water power and dams at Stantec. “Developers, power utilities and grid operators are seeing an opportunity to incorporate pumped storage solutions.”

Pumped storage hydropower is an energy storage technology that plays a crucial role in stabilizing power grids, balancing electricity supply and demand, and integrating renewable energy sources into national grids.
Greater levels of intermittent renewables on energy systems around the world will make pumped storage all the more vital in helping to balance grids. Their mountainous locations also make pumped storage stations some of the most dramatic and interesting monuments in energy.
